The Acreage Buyer Has Changed 

Acreage buyers today aren’t just looking for more land; they’re looking for a better lifestyle. While space is still important, it’s not the only factor. More and more buyers are coming from the city, hoping to trade density and noise for privacy, flexibility, and room to grow. But that doesn’t mean they’ll settle for outdated layouts or high-maintenance properties. 

These buyers want a rural lifestyle without rural headaches. They want a home that feels modern and livable, land that’s usable and not overwhelming, and systems that are reliable, efficient, and easy to manage. Knowing what matters to them, and what turns them off, can make the difference between a long listing and a fast sale. 

1. Modern, Move-In-Ready Interiors 

Most acreage buyers want the peaceful lifestyle of country living—but they still expect modern finishes. Open-concept layouts, updated kitchens, spa-style bathrooms, and functional mudrooms go a long way. Homes with dated interiors, small rooms, or poorly lit spaces tend to sit longer on the market or sell below asking. 

If your home hasn’t been updated in the last 10–15 years, it may be worth refreshing paint, lighting, and key surfaces before listing. But don’t overdo it—buyers care more about flow and function than flashy upgrades. 

2. Usable, Manageable Land 

While “acreage” implies lots of space, buyers are increasingly focused on how that space is laid out and whether it serves a purpose. Flat, fenced land is more appealing than steep, overgrown, or unusable terrain. A defined yard space, cleared tree lines, and easy access to outbuildings or garages all add value. 

Buyers want enough land to feel private, but not so much that it becomes a burden. If your property has been well-maintained, show it off. If areas are underused or cluttered, clean them up before listing. 

3. Well-Maintained Systems 

Rural buyers ask smart questions about septic, well water, heating, and drainage—especially in fall and winter. If any of your systems are outdated or showing signs of wear, expect pushback during negotiations. On the flip side, having clear maintenance records, upgrades, or professional servicing in place can help build trust and reduce buyer hesitation. 

Bonus points if your acreage includes added infrastructure like solar panels, a backup generator, or energy-efficient windows—these signal long-term value and self-sufficiency. 

4. Space for Hobbies, Home Offices, or Multi-Generational Living 

Today’s acreage buyers aren’t just thinking about family life—they’re thinking about functionality. Many want space to run a business, homeschool, host extended family, or store recreational vehicles. Garages, workshops, home offices, and flexible rooms are all huge selling features. 

If your property includes a bonus structure, finished basement suite, or multi-use outbuilding, highlight its potential clearly. Buyers love knowing they can adapt the space to suit their needs. 

5. A Balance of Privacy and Proximity 

Acreages near Calgary’s outskirts (like Springbank, Bearspaw, or Elbow Valley) remain popular because they strike the balance buyers want: peace and quiet without feeling disconnected. Most rural buyers still want to be within 15–45 minutes of downtown, major highways, schools, and services. 

If your location offers this kind of access, make sure it’s front and centre in your listing and viewings. Buyers want lifestyle, but they also want convenience.
